Vero was founded in 2017 with a focus on bridging the digital divide by serving schools and libraries in unserved and underserved areas. We have also established a fiber to the premises business that directly serves residential and small business customers in underserved regions. In addition, we now serve a small subset of large business and wholesale customers - which we typically use as a springboard for our consumer focused services for underserved communities. Our management team brings decades of experience in building and operating fiber networks for various customer segments, including residential, business, and wholesale clients. 

This position is remote (within the United States) and responsible for overall project management (schedule and budget) for multiple large fiber optic construction projects. Reports to Regional Director of Operations.

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Key responsibilities include:

  • Oversight of acquisition process for long haul deployment facilities, including management of vendors, analyzing segment distances to identify target site areas, and negotiating and coordinating agreements with land owners for the acquisition of properties.
  • Coordinating with vendors and reviewing documentation such as title reports, surveys, ALTA commitments, phase 1 ESA reports, geotechnical surveys and reports.
  • Coordinating documentation between title companies, legal firms, vendors, and owners, including the closing of the final site acquisition agreements. 
  • Procurement of critical infrastructure components and electrical utility to each site, and gaining necessary municipal and environmental approvals. 
  • Oversight of the site construction process, including telecom shelter placement, telecom shelter integration, and site test, turn up and handoff..
  • Identification of candidate OSP engineering/construction firms, managing bid/vendor selection process and contract negotiation.
  • Performing service delivery functions, including providing regular customer updates (written and/or oral), coordinating site access, and close out package preparation
  • Working with local/state/federal permitting agencies to secure timely permit approvals and managing environmental engineering vendors and related subcontractors as they secure related permitting 
  • Documenting splicing requirements and maintaining fiber engineering documentation
  • Tactical project management, including managing project schedules, running regular project calls and performing support project functions (such as securing bonds, internal signatures for permits, etc.)
  • Providing build cost estimates for sales team
  • Maintaining up-to-date network maps in Vero’s proprietary geospatial project management platform, including in-flight design changes and final as-built routes
  • Providing accurate network maps to state 811 agencies and Vero Networks NOC as well as provide configuration, monitoring, and troubleshooting details for operations
